What type of lubricating oil is used in the oil injection system of reciprocating compressors? What are the specific requirements? What is the difference from the lubricant used for the moving parts of compressors?
Our compressor oiling system uses 150# compressor oil, while the operating system uses 68# lubricating oil. Mainly: the viscosity used ; Good adsorption and wedging capacity ; It has high purity and antioxidant properties, is non-corrosive, and does not deteriorate easily under the influence of water or air.
150# mechanical oil for high-power reciprocating machines; Use 68# mechanical oil for capacities below 100 kW ; In winter, use No. 13 compressor oil in the oil injector; in summer, use No. 19 compressor oil.
For the reciprocating compressors in my hydrogen production and hydrogenation units, the compressors for fresh hydrogen use L-DAB150, while those used for hydrogen production and membrane separation applications use L-TSA68. The oil used for lubricating reciprocating units and their moving parts is directly related to the compressor’s load/media: compressors with higher exhaust temperatures require oils with a higher viscosity; Based on experience: for the moving parts of small and medium-sized units, HL68 is suitable, while DAB150 can be used for lubrication. For the moving parts of large units, DAB150 is used, and the lubricant should be of a grade higher than 150, as excessively high exhaust temperatures can cause oil of grade 150 to clog, which hinders the proper functioning of the valves (this is just experience-based advice for reference only) :)
